example example 1

[0009] Weigh 10g of polyferric sulfate, 0.2g of solid ferrate, measure 25ml of 11% sodium hypochlorite, add distilled water to 100ml, mix thoroughly, let it stand for 24 hours, and configure it into an aqueous solution of oxidation coagulant, then weigh 0.1g of polyacrylamide auxiliary Coagulant, add distilled water to configure 100ml of 0.1% aqueous solution.

[0010] Take 1000ml of biochemical effluent from coking wastewater, and do coagulation experiment at 25°C. First, add 2ml of oxidation-coagulant, stir for 30s, then add 3ml of coagulant, stir for 1min, and settle for 30min.

[0011] The experimental situation and results are as follows: the alum flowers are dense, the flocs settle well, the supernatant is clear, and the COD Cr The removal rate can reach 71%, and the chromaticity is less than 80 times.

example example 2

[0013] According to the flocculant polymerized ferric sulfate 15g, solid ferrate 0.8g, add distilled water to 100ml, mix well, let it stand for 24 hours, and configure it as an oxidation coagulant aqueous solution, then weigh 0.2g polyacrylamide coagulant, add distilled water to configure into 100ml of 0.1% aqueous solution.

[0014] Take 1000ml of biochemical effluent from coking wastewater, and do coagulation experiment at 25°C. First, add 2ml of oxidized coagulant, stir for 30s quickly, then add 3ml of coagulant, stir for 1min, and settle for 30min.

[0015] The experimental results are as follows: the alum flowers are dense, the flocs settle well, the supernatant is clear, and the COD Cr The removal rate can reach 70%. Chroma is 280.

example example 3

[0017] According to the flocculant polymerized ferric sulfate 18g, solid ferrate 1.5g, add distilled water to 100ml, mix well, let it stand for 24 hours, and configure it as an oxidation coagulant aqueous solution, then weigh 0.2g polyacrylamide coagulant, add distilled water to configure into 100ml of 0.1% aqueous solution.

[0018] Take 1000ml of biochemical effluent from coking wastewater, and do coagulation experiment at 25°C. First, add 2ml of oxidized coagulant, stir for 30s quickly, then add 3ml of coagulant, stir for 1min, and settle for 30min.

[0019] The experimental results are as follows: the alum flowers are dense, the flocs settle well, the supernatant is clear, and the COD Cr The removal rate can reach 70%. Chroma is 240.

Abstract

The invention discloses an oxidization coagulant for treating coking wastewater, which consists of two parts of an oxidization flocculant and a coagulant aid. The oxidization flocculant comprises the following components according to proportion by weight: 8-20% of flocculant polyferric sulfate, 0.1-2.0% of oxidant ferrate and the balance of water; and the coagulant aid is polyacrylamide aqueous solution. In the invention, the double functions of oxidization and flocculation are available, the removal rate of the coking wastewater CODcr (Chemical Oxygen Demand) can reach more than 70%, the draining water is clear, the colority is less than 80 times, the adding amount is little, and the cost is low, wherein the medicament cost of advanced treatment is only 0.5 RMB / ton; the condition is easy to control and the operation is convenient. The invention provides an economical and efficient method and powerful assurances for the draining standard of advanced treatment of the coking wastewater.

Description

technical field [0001] The invention relates to a water treatment agent, in particular to an oxidation coagulant used for physical and chemical treatment of coking wastewater after it reaches a secondary settling tank through a biochemical treatment section. Background technique [0002] The pollutant composition of coking wastewater is complex, containing volatile phenols and many refractory aromatic organic compounds, polycyclic compounds and oxygen, sulfur and nitrogen compounds. It is a typical difficult-to-treat organic industrial wastewater, so the treatment of coking wastewater has always been a A major problem in wastewater treatment. At present, most coking wastewater enterprises in China use biochemical method combined with physicochemical method to treat coking wastewater.
